Lupton’s grand ambition revealed and theft of the crystal

Barnes awakens Lupton with urgent news of Sarah’s return with the Doctor, but Lupton dismisses the immediate threat to boast of his grand ambition. He reveals his long-held desire to seize control of the world, his voice dripping with venom as he describes his fantasy of subjugating others. As Lupton’s speech swells with delusional power, Tommy silently slips through the window and plucks the Metebelis crystal from the desk. The theft goes unnoticed, yet its implications are seismic, shifting the balance of power and foreshadowing Lupton’s violent retaliation. key_dialogue: [ LUPTON: I came here to get power. Do you think I'm going to let go now when it's in sight, when I can see myself taking over that firm, taking over the country, the entire stinking world. I want to see them grovel, I want to see them breaking their hearts, I want to see them eating dirt. ]
